I-ology®, Inc. CEO Trish Bear to present at 2003 Arizona Hospitality Expo
Internet Strategy Expert to Arm Attendees with Keys to Maximizing Web Investment; I-ology to Exhibit
SCOTTSDALE, AZ – October 20, 2003 – I-ology®, Inc., a leading Internet strategy firm, today announced that its CEO, Trish Bear, will be a seminar presenter at the upcoming 2003 Arizona Hospitality Expo. In addition, I–ology will be showcasing its portfolio of Internet services as an Expo exhibitor (Booth #710). Formerly known as the "Great Southwest Lodging & Restaurant Show", the Hospitality Expo will take place October 29-30 at the Phoenix Civic Plaza.
Ms. Bear will be presenting on "Creating An Effective Internet Strategy For A Hospitality Business" on Wednesday October 29 from 3:00 – 3:30 p.m. in room Tucson 43. This presentation is part of the Expo´s Hospitality MEGA Marketing Seminars. These seminars spotlight industry experts who will educate the audience on proven marketing methods that can be quickly implemented to drive tangible business results.
The Hospitality Expo is expected to draw over 4,000 attendees, primarily from Arizona, Utah, New Mexico, and southern California, and more than 350 suppliers servicing the hospitality industry. For additional information, visit www.azhospitalityexpo.org.

Ms. Bear is an eight-year veteran of the Internet marketing and consulting industry. Prior to founding I-ology, she managed the commercial Web services division of GlobalCenter, a provider of commercial Web site hosting, design and development, which was acquired by the publicly held company Global Crossing in 1998. Under the leadership of Ms. Bear, I-ology has been recognized for achievements in growth several times including being ranked as the fastest growing woman-owned business in Arizona two years in a row and was named as one of the top 50 fastest growing technology firms by the Phoenix Business Journal. In addition, Ms. Bear was named as a top Young Entrepreneur in Arizona by bizAZ Magazine. Most recently, the Web Marketing Association, an organization dedicated to setting a high-standard for Internet marketing and corporate Web site development, named two Web sites developed by I-ology as 2003 WebAward recipients.
